The inherent volatility of Dogecoin is undeniable. Its price is susceptible to dramatic swings based on a variety of factors, many of which are outside the traditional economic indicators that influence more established currencies. Social media sentiment plays a massive role. Elon Musk's tweets, for instance, have historically been significant catalysts for both bullish and bearish runs. A positive tweet can send the price soaring, while a negative one can trigger a sharp decline. This dependence on external, often unpredictable, factors makes predicting Dogecoin's price movement exceptionally challenging.

However, there are some underlying factors that could contribute to potential price increases. The growing adoption of cryptocurrency in general is one such factor. As more people become comfortable using and investing in digital currencies, the overall market cap expands, potentially benefitting Dogecoin as part of this broader ecosystem. Increased institutional interest is another positive sign. While still relatively small compared to Bitcoin or Ethereum, the gradual involvement of larger players can provide a degree of stability and increase trading volume, which in turn can influence price.

The Dogecoin community itself is a powerful force. The vibrant and dedicated fanbase actively promotes the currency and fosters a sense of community ownership. This strong community engagement can drive demand and create a sense of resilience, even during periods of market downturn. The development team's efforts to improve Dogecoin's technology and scalability are also important. While Dogecoin is not known for its technological innovation in the same way as some other cryptocurrencies, ongoing improvements in transaction speed and efficiency can enhance its appeal to a wider range of users.

Despite these positive factors, it's crucial to acknowledge the risks. The highly speculative nature of Dogecoin means significant price drops are always a possibility. Market corrections are a regular occurrence in the cryptocurrency world, and Dogecoin is particularly susceptible to these fluctuations. Furthermore, the lack of inherent value compared to currencies backed by governments or commodities adds another layer of risk. Dogecoin's value is largely determined by supply and demand, making it prone to manipulation and speculative bubbles.
